研究生期间第一篇博文

好久没有更新博客了,这两年好像一直在忙,也不知道忙的是什么。自从2015年9月进入大三,就离开了ACM实验室,开始着手准备考研。没有离开的时候,想着大三不去写代码,不去研究枯燥的算法,总觉得自己的生活会过得很轻松,可是当我真正收拾自己的东西离开座位的瞬间,对整个实验室充满了不舍。大三的时候每天除了上课就是去图书馆,大三的时候专业课比较多,计算机网络,计算机组成原理,操作系统,这三门专业都是在大三的时候开始学的。大三的时候就想好好学习,能在大三学年结束的时候拿到奖学金,每天晚上都会和小伙伴们一起去启航上考研课。每次听商志的英语都会记很多笔记(虽然这些笔记很少再会看第二遍),听他的课总会让我们很振奋,相信很多考研的小伙伴都会有这种感觉吧。大四的时候,我们学校就没有课,全心全意的投入自己考研的复习,当时定的目标是郑州大学,考研的这一年经历了很多事,那时候每周给家人打电话的时候,总会给家人说考研好难,好多不会。虽然我知道说这些父母也不能给我什么帮助,但是我还是觉得说出来会好一点。现在回首看自己本科的生活,考研这次经历锻炼了我很多,也让我成长了很多。2017年6月我正式拿到郑州大学的录取通知书,就这样,继续我的上学生涯,由于本科没有学过java,现在在做项目的时候,要学习的东西很多。

从2017年8月份开始写代码到现在接触更多的就是前台和后天的交互,简单总结一下项目中使用的两种交互方法:

前台选择开始日期
 <div class="layui-input-inline">
       <input type="text" class="layui-input" id="test1" name="date1" value="<s:property value="#date1"/>">
 </div>  
后台获取前台的值	                                           
HttpServletRequest request = ServletActionContext.getRequest();                         
String date1 = request.getParameter("date1");// 开始时间
把后台的值传给前台                                                                                                      
ActionContext.getContext().put("date1", date1);
前台代码:异步请求传值(首尾图片ID:swyid)
$.ajax({                           		    
               type: "POST",  
               url: "${pageContext.request.contextPath}/swyPicture_swypicid.action", //发送请求  
               data: {swypid:id},  
               dataType:"json",                    
                success: function(result) {                     
                       }                     
        })   
后台获取方法:	
	// 获取当前行的id
	public String swypicid() throws Exception {
		if(swypid!=null && !"".equals(swypid)){		
			ServletActionContext.getRequest().getSession().setAttribute("swypid",swypid);
		}	
			
        HttpServletResponse response=ServletActionContext.getResponse();
        response.setCharacterEncoding("utf-8");
		PrintWriter printWriter=response.getWriter();
		printWriter.write(JSON.toJSONString("success"));
		printWriter.close();			
		return null;	
	}
异步请求后台向前台传值//attPa                                                                             
	public String showpic() throws Exception {
		
		Long swyPid = new Long(0);
if(ServletActionContext.getRequest().getSession().getAttribute("swypid")!=null && !"".equals(ServletActionContext.getRequest().
getSession().getAttribute("swypid")))
		{
			
			swyPid=Long.parseLong(ServletActionContext.getRequest().getSession().getAttribute("swypid").toString());
		}
		
		// 获取显示图片的附件路径
		SwyPicture swyp = swyPictureService.getById(swyPid);		
		String attPa = swyp.getAttPath();
		if(attPa!=null && !"".equals(attPa)){		
	        ServletActionContext.getRequest().getSession().setAttribute("attPa",attPa);//向后台传值
		}	
			
		HttpServletResponse response = ServletActionContext.getResponse();
		response.setCharacterEncoding("utf-8");	
		PrintWriter printWriter = response.getWriter();
		printWriter.write(attPa);  //传给前台
		printWriter.close();
		return null;
     }                     
前台获取方法:
 function show() {        var url = "${pageContext.request.contextPath}/swyPicture_showpic.action";    	
 		          $.post(url,function(attPa){      //获取attPa                                                                     		
 		          var imgpath=attPa;                                                          						
                          var tid=$("tr[bgcolor='#eceeef']");                                       		
			 	var id=tid.attr("id");											              
    				var imgstr = $(['<img src="'
	                      ,'/file/' + imgpath
	                      ,'" id="img' 
	                      ,'" style="margin-bottom: 5px;width: 60%"/>'].join(''));                 
	            $("#testDataImg").empty();             
	            $("#testDataImg").prepend(imgstr);     		 
             });		    		     
                                                     
	}; 
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值